What the App does on your devices
Screen capture and streaming
When you start a BeamRoom session as a host:
- The App uses Apple’s ReplayKit framework to capture the device’s screen and, if enabled, microphone audio.
- Captured frames are encoded into video on the device.
- The encoded stream is sent over the local network to viewer devices that have joined the room.
We do not operate servers that relay or record this stream. However, viewers can see anything that appears on your screen while sharing is active, and they may be able to record or capture it on their own devices. Only share with people you trust.
Networking
BeamRoom uses Apple’s networking frameworks (including Network.framework and related technologies) to:
- Discover nearby devices (for example via Wi-Fi and peer-to-peer mechanisms).
- Exchange room information such as pairing codes and connection details.
- Send encoded video and audio packets between host and viewers.
Connections are intended for local, nearby use. We do not run a central service that routes this traffic.
Local storage
The App stores information such as:
- Basic settings and preferences (for example quality presets).
- Local pairing and room history.
- Purchase status, kept so that Pro features remain unlocked.
This data is stored on your device and, where needed, shared with the BeamRoom broadcast extension using an App Group. It is not transmitted to our own servers.
Optional recording
If you enable a recording feature in BeamRoom:
- The host device may save a recording (such as an MP4 file) locally.
- Recordings are stored in the device’s storage (for example in the Files app or Photos), depending on how the feature is implemented.
- We do not receive copies of these recordings.
You can delete recordings at any time from within the relevant system app.
